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20785461399 6507435327 88547284
525934 642 7998
525934 642 7998
987 6763 10657393
All about undefined
Interested in learning more?
525934 642 7998
987 6763 10657393
See more
71497571 6571 2823481350
11855637 0124874935 77330140
See more
561 0525
906 6161824 66636 77323844
See more